Slither snake - role play paint activity

Make snake paint stampers that can be finger pushed across paper and card, creating trails of paint.
Give your craft snaketers and role play with them using foliage , twigs and leaves.

 snake Display area resources:

  A plain canvas covered in metallic wrapping paper as the base.
  2 x long brown plastic ornamental grass stalks - available from many florist and miscellaneous stores.
  A shredded green serviette or tissue paper to resemble grass.
  Shallow trays for paint colours
  Optional – PVA glue to attach the green paper strips
  Paper to mark make on.
  Selection of pre made snake stampers and blank paper and mark making tools for child led innovations.

 Have fun dipping, slipping and sliding snake stampers over the paper flooring. Extend to finger painting and dipped, dragged chunky lengths of yarn/string or acrylic wool.
snake About snakes
R
isk, health, safety, first aid:


Snake bites in the UK are rare.
The only venomous snake is the Adder - viper.
Adders are most commonly encountered in long grass during April through to October or on sand dunes.
Snakes strike in self defense if they feel threatened, if they are suddenly disturbed or provoked.
They are timid and with enough warning will leave an area.

 St John Ambulance - poisoning

 Enable children to protect themselves and provide information on how to avoid bites when outdoors

 -- turn stones over with a stick, lift gently and replace.
 -- play in long, deep grass that has been checked, noise cleared.
 -- not to approach or touch a snake that looks 'dead or sleeping.
